数控铣床编程l是什么意思
-
数控铣床编程是指利用计算机控制数控铣床进行加工的过程。在数控铣床编程中,需要根据零件的图纸和加工要求,通过编写程序来指导数控铣床进行加工操作。
数控铣床编程的意思可以分为两个方面。首先,它是指将零件的几何形状和加工要求转化为数控铣床可以理解和执行的指令的过程。这个过程需要根据数控铣床的工作原理和功能特点,结合零件的形状和加工要求,编写出相应的程序。
其次,数控铣床编程还包括了设定加工参数和工艺路线的过程。在编程中,需要设定加工速度、切削深度、进给速度等参数,以及选择合适的刀具和夹具,确定加工顺序和切削路径等。这些参数和工艺路线的设定对于零件的加工质量和效率都有很大的影响。
总的来说,数控铣床编程是将零件的几何形状和加工要求转化为数控铣床可以理解和执行的指令,并设定合适的加工参数和工艺路线的过程。它是数控铣床加工的关键环节,能够提高加工效率和精度,实现高效、精准的零件加工。
1年前 -
数控铣床编程(NC milling machine programming)是指使用计算机或编程设备编写程序,控制数控铣床进行加工操作的过程。下面是关于数控铣床编程的五个要点:
-
意义:数控铣床编程是将加工工艺和操作步骤通过编程语言转化为机器能够理解和执行的指令,使数控铣床能够自动进行复杂的加工操作,提高生产效率和加工精度。
-
编程语言:数控铣床编程通常使用的是G代码和M代码。G代码用于定义运动轨迹、加工速度和切削参数等,M代码用于控制辅助功能,如刀具换刀、冷却液开关等。编程人员需要了解这些代码的含义和使用方法。
-
编程过程:数控铣床编程的过程包括确定加工工艺、选择合适的刀具和夹具、确定加工路径和切削参数、编写程序代码,以及调试和优化程序等。编程人员需要具备良好的数学和机械知识,以及对加工工艺和机床性能的理解。
-
编程软件:为了方便编程,通常会使用专门的数控编程软件,如Mastercam、Powermill等。这些软件提供了直观的界面和丰富的功能,可以进行三维建模、路径规划、刀具轨迹模拟等操作,帮助编程人员更高效地编写程序。
-
编程技巧:在进行数控铣床编程时,编程人员需要考虑刀具的选择、加工路径的规划、切削参数的设定等因素,以确保加工结果符合要求。同时,还需要注意编写清晰、简洁、易于理解和修改的程序代码,以提高编程效率和程序的可维护性。此外,经验丰富的编程人员还可以根据具体情况使用一些优化技巧,如采用高速切削路径、合理分配切削量等,以提高加工效率和质量。
1年前 -
-
数控铣床编程l是指使用计算机编写程序来控制数控铣床进行加工操作的过程。在数控铣床编程中,l通常表示一个指令或者一个功能码,具体意思根据不同的编程系统和控制器而有所差异。下面将介绍数控铣床编程的一般操作流程。
1.了解数控铣床的基本知识
在进行数控铣床编程之前,需要了解数控铣床的基本知识,包括机床的结构和工作原理,控制系统的操作界面和功能,以及刀具和工件的加工特点等。2.确定加工工艺和加工参数
根据工件的要求和加工工艺,确定加工的切削速度、进给速度、切削深度等加工参数。这些参数将在编程过程中使用。3.选择合适的编程方式
数控铣床编程可以采用手工编程和自动编程两种方式。手工编程需要根据机床的坐标系和刀具的运动规律进行编写,而自动编程可以通过CAD/CAM软件生成刀具路径和加工程序。4.绘制零件图和刀具路径
使用CAD软件或者手绘图纸绘制工件的零件图,并根据加工工艺确定刀具路径。刀具路径包括切削轮廓、孔加工、倒角等操作。5.编写数控程序
根据绘制的刀具路径和加工参数,使用数控编程语言编写数控程序。数控编程语言一般包括G代码和M代码。G代码用于控制刀具的运动,包括直线插补、圆弧插补、螺旋插补等;M代码用于控制机床的辅助功能,如冷却液开关、主轴启停等。6.调试和优化程序
编写完数控程序后,需要进行调试和优化。可以通过模拟器或者机床的手动模式进行程序的调试,检查刀具路径是否正确,加工过程是否符合要求。7.上传程序到数控铣床
将编写好的数控程序上传到数控铣床的控制器中。可以通过U盘、网络、串口等方式进行传输。8.进行加工操作
在数控铣床上设置合适的工件坐标系和刀具坐标系,加载刀具,并进行刀具长度和半径的补偿。然后启动程序,数控铣床将按照编写的程序进行自动加工操作。9.检查加工质量
加工完成后,需要对加工质量进行检查。可以使用测量工具进行尺寸测量,检查加工结果是否符合要求。总结:
数控铣床编程是使用计算机编写程序来控制数控铣床进行加工操作的过程。它包括了了解数控铣床的基本知识、确定加工工艺和参数、选择编程方式、绘制零件图和刀具路径、编写数控程序、调试和优化程序、上传程序到数控铣床、进行加工操作和检查加工质量等步骤。通过合理的编程和操作,可以实现高精度、高效率的加工。1年前